Sloped yard landscaping services focus on managing uneven terrain to create a functional and attractive outdoor space. These services typically involve grading the yard to correct slopes, installing retaining walls, and shaping the landscape to prevent erosion and water runoff issues. Properly addressing a sloped yard can help homeowners improve drainage, reduce the risk of soil erosion, and create level areas for lawns, gardens, patios, or other outdoor features. This type of work often requires specialized equipment and expertise to ensure the landscape is both stable and visually appealing.
Many property owners encounter problems related to sloped yards that can impact safety and usability. For instance, steep slopes can cause water to flow toward foundations or walkways, leading to flooding or damage over time. Erosion may wash away topsoil, making plantings difficult to establish or maintain. Additionally, uneven ground can pose safety hazards, particularly for families with children or elderly residents. Sloped yard landscaping services are designed to address these issues by reshaping the terrain, installing drainage solutions, and providing support structures that stabilize the soil.

The overview below groups typical Sloped Yard Landsc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Reno, NV.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or slope yard landscaping repairs in the Reno area range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as fixing drainage issues or minor grading, tend to fall within this range. Fewer projects reach the higher end unless additional work is needed.
Mid-Size Projects - Larger, more involved landscaping projects generally c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These may include reshaping slopes, installing retaining walls, or adding new plantings, with most projects falling into this middle range. Complex or extensive work can push costs higher.
Full Yard Overhauls - Complete slope yard redesigns or significant landscape renovations often range from $4,000 to $8,000. Many local contractors handle projects in this range, though larger or more intricate designs can exceed $10,000.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Very large or highly customized landscaping jobs, such as extensive terracing or drainage systems, can cost $10,000 or more. These projects are less common and typically involve detailed planning and specialized work by experienced service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of sloped yard landscaping? Sloped yard landscaping can improve drainage, prevent erosion, and enhance the visual appeal of a property by creating terraced levels or retaining walls.
What types of features can local contractors install on a sloped yard? They can install retaining walls, steps, terraces, drainage solutions, and planting beds to make the slope functional and attractive.
How do professionals handle drainage issues on a sloped yard? Local service providers typically incorporate drainage systems like french drains, swales, or proper grading to manage water flow effectively.
Are there specific plants suitable for sloped yard landscaping? Yes, many local pros recommend plants with strong root systems that help stabilize soil and prevent erosion, suitable for the area's climate.
What considerations are important when designing a sloped yard? Factors such as soil stability, water runoff, accessibility, and the desired aesthetic are key to creating a functional and appealing landscape.
